John Hinckley Jr., who shot President Ronald Reagan in 1981 outside the Washington Hilton, called it 'spooky' that a new alleged assassination attempt on former President Donald Trump occurred at the same hotel during the 2026 White House Correspondents' Dinner. Hinckley criticized the venue's security and suggested it should not host large events. The suspect, Cole Allen, opened fire at the event, injuring a Secret Service agent before being apprehended. Trump and other officials were safely evacuated.
